1982 Warren Zevon – The Envoy
The Envoy is the fifth studio album by American singer/songwriter Warren Zevon, released in 1982 by Asylum, but was not released on compact disc until 2006. The album’s lack of commercial success caused Zevon’s label to terminate his recording contract, a fact that Zevon discovered only after reading about it in Rolling Stone. In reaction, Zevon went on a self-destructive binge that nearly killed him, followed by a rehab stint that kept Zevon clean and sober until the last year of his life.
The title track was inspired by veteran American diplomat Philip Habib’s shuttle diplomacy during Israel’s Lebanon incursion of 1982.
